[0033] Example 1

[0034] like figure 1 As shown, the precipitation forecast and early warning system of the complex terrain watershed of the present invention includes a weather live data module, a weather forecast data module, a forecast checking module, an information query module and a background management module.

[0035] The weather live data module includes collected rainfall, area rainfall, soil moisture and real-time early warning data:

[0036] Rainfall: rainfall monitored in real time by telemetry rainfall stations and automatic monitoring stations of the Meteorological Bureau within the basin;

[0037] Effective areal rainfall: Through the effective areal rainfall algorithm, the effective areal rainfall within the basin can be calculated in real time;

[0038] Soil moisture: soil moisture data monitored in real time by the soil moisture monitoring station;

Abstract

The invention discloses a rainfall forecasting and early warning system for a complex terrain drainage basin. The rainfall forecasting and early warning system comprises a weather actual condition data module, a weather forecasting data module, a forecasting inspection module, an information query module and a background management module, the weather actual condition data module comprises collected rainfall, surface rainfall, soil humidity and real-time early warning data; the weather forecasting module comprises a short-term proximity forecasting module, a short-term and medium-term forecasting module and a long-term forecasting module, and the forecasting and checking module is used for checking the rainfall and the effective surface rainfall forecasted in the drainage basin range and the actual monitoring result to obtain the forecasting accuracy and deviation. Aiming at the problems that the rainfall forecasting range is not fine and the forecasting accuracy is low, the latest radar, rapid assimilation, multiple modes and other numerical forecasting results are utilized, and the actual underlying surface condition in the drainage basin range is combined to research and developa rainfall forecasting product which is updated hour by hour in the future 6 hours. The product can effectively make up for the defects of time and accuracy of existing rainfall forecasting.

technical field [0001] The invention relates to a hydropower dispatching and commanding system, in particular to a precipitation forecasting and early warning system in complex terrain basins, and belongs to the field of hydropower emergency management and information technology. Background technique [0002] Scientific and safe hydropower production scheduling is not only related to the economic benefits of the hydropower industry, but also to the national economy and people's livelihood. Through scientific scheduling, the hydropower department opens the gates to generate electricity before the flood peak, which not only improves economic benefits, but also prevents dam breaks and effectively prevents the impact of floods on people's lives and properties. The most direct factor affecting hydropower production scheduling is the amount of atmospheric rainfall.
